Як я магу выправіць пабітыя залежнасці ў Debian?

Як выправіць адсутныя залежнасці ў Debian?

Выпраўце пабітыя залежнасці пакетаў ад Debian GNU / Linux, Ubuntu, Mint з дапамогай каманд apt, як

  1. apt-атрымаць абнаўленне. …
  2. apt-ачысціцеся. …
  3. apt-атрымаць аўтаматычнае выдаленне. …
  4. apt-атрымаць абнаўленне -выправіць-адсутнічае. …
  5. dpkg –канфігураваць -a. …
  6. apt-get install -f. …
  7. dpkg -l | grep -v '^ii' ...
  8. dpkg-query -f '${status} ${package}n' -W | awk '$3 != "усталявана" {print $4}'

Як выправіць зламаныя пакеты ў Linux?

Спачатку запусціце абнаўленне, каб пераканацца, што няма больш новых версій неабходных пакетаў. Далей можна паспрабаваць прымушаючы апт шукаць і выпраўляць любыя адсутнічаюць залежнасці або зламаныя пакеты. Гэта дазволіць усталяваць любыя адсутнічаюць пакеты і адрамантаваць існуючыя ўстаноўкі.

Як вырашыце праблемы з залежнасцю?

Калі ўзнікаюць гэтыя памылкі залежнасці, у нас ёсць некалькі варыянтаў, якія мы можам паспрабаваць вырашыць гэтую праблему.

  1. Уключыць усе рэпазітары.
  2. Абнавіць праграмнае забеспячэнне.
  3. Абнавіце праграмнае забеспячэнне.
  4. Ачысціце залежнасці пакета.
  5. Ачысціць кэшаваныя пакеты.
  6. Выдаліце ​​пакеты «на ўтрыманні» або «затрыманыя».
  7. Выкарыстоўвайце сцяг -f з падкамандай install.
  8. Выкарыстоўвайце каманду build-dep.

Як я магу выправіць незадаволеныя залежнасці ў Linux?

Як прадухіліць і выправіць памылкі залежнасці пакета ў Ubuntu

  1. Пакеты абнаўленняў. …
  2. Пакеты абнаўленняў. …
  3. Ачысціце кэшаваныя і рэшткавыя пакеты. …
  4. Зрабіце імітацыйную ўстаноўку. …
  5. Выправіць зламаныя пакеты. …
  6. Наладзіць пакеты не ўдалося ўсталяваць з-за перапынкаў. …
  7. Выкарыстоўвайце PPA-Purge. …
  8. Выкарыстоўвайце менеджэр пакетаў Aptitude.

Як выправіць, што наступныя пакеты маюць незадаволеныя залежнасці?

Калі ласка, увядзіце sudo aptitude ўсталяваць PACKAGENAME, дзе PACKAGENAME - гэта пакет, які вы ўсталёўваеце, і націсніце Enter, каб выканаць яго. Гэта паспрабуе ўсталяваць пакет праз aptitude замест apt-get, што патэнцыйна павінна выправіць праблему з незадаволенымі залежнасцямі.

Як выправіць парушаную ўстаноўку?

Ubuntu выправіць зламаны пакет (лепшае рашэнне)

  1. sudo apt-атрымаць абнаўленне -выпраўленне-адсутнічае.
  2. sudo dpkg –канфігураваць -a.
  3. sudo apt-get install -f.
  4. Разблакіраваць dpkg - (паведамленне /var/lib/dpkg/lock)
  5. sudo fuser -vki /var/lib/dpkg/lock.
  6. sudo dpkg –канфігураваць -a.

Як уручную запусціць dpkg configure a?

Выканайце каманду, якую яна кажа вам sudo dpkg –наладка -a і гэта павінна быць у стане выправіць сябе. Калі ён не спрабуе запусціць sudo apt-get install -f (каб выправіць зламаныя пакеты), а затым зноў паспрабуйце запусціць sudo dpkg –configure -a. Проста пераканайцеся, што ў вас ёсць доступ да Інтэрнэту, каб вы маглі загружаць любыя залежнасці.

Што значыць sudo dpkg?

dpkg - гэта праграмнае забеспячэнне, якое формы нізкаўзроўневая база сістэмы кіравання пакетамі Debian. Гэта менеджэр пакетаў па змаўчанні ў Ubuntu. Вы можаце выкарыстоўваць dpkg, каб усталяваць, наладзіць, абнавіць або выдаліць пакеты Debian, а таксама атрымаць інфармацыю аб гэтых пакетах Debian.

Як знайсці адсутнічаюць залежнасці ў Linux?

Паглядзіце спіс залежнасцяў выкананага файла:

  1. Для apt каманда такая: apt-cache залежыць Гэта дазволіць праверыць пакет у рэпазітарах і пералічыць залежнасці, а таксама «прапанаваныя» пакеты. …
  2. Для dpkg , каманда для яго запуску ў лакальным файле: dpkg -I file.deb | grep Залежыць. dpkg -I файл.

Як вы можаце вырашыць, што вы не можаце выправіць праблемы, у якіх вы трымалі зламаныя пакеты?

Вось некалькі хуткіх і простых спосабаў выправіць памылку зламаных пакетаў.

  1. Адкрыйце свае крыніцы. …
  2. Выберыце опцыю Выправіць зламаныя пакеты ў дыспетчаре пакетаў Synaptic. …
  3. Калі вы атрымліваеце гэта паведамленне пра памылку: паспрабуйце 'apt-get -f install' без пакетаў (або пакажыце рашэнне) ...
  4. Выдаліце ​​зламаную ўпакоўку ўручную.

Як выдаліць незадаволеныя залежнасці?

Вы можаце ігнараваць першую каманду, калі вы не хочаце выдаляць усталяваны пакет.

  1. sudo apt-get autoremove –purge PACKAGENAME.
  2. sudo add-apt-repository – выдаліць ppa:someppa/ppa.
  3. sudo apt-атрымаць аўтаачыстку.
Падабаецца гэты пост? Калі ласка, падзяліцеся з сябрамі:
АС сёння